Patt20169

Download a large file multi threading java

Can your browser download an indefinite number of files and Web pages at once The multithreading support in Java revolves around the concept of a thread. This implies that synchronizing a large, long-running method is almost always a  This was a Java NIO Large File Transfer tutorial. Download You can download the full source code of this example  Aug 3, 2014 Instead of having to download the large file over and over again from the local system, and supports multiple download threads, authentication and options to Free Rapid Downloader - The program requires Java to run. Let us start by creating a Python module, named download.py . This file will contain all the functions necessary to fetch the list of images and download This is why Python multithreading can provide a large speed increase. NET framework, does not have a GIL, and neither does Jython, the Java-based implementation.

Mar 16, 2017 we frequently have to download, parse and save huge amounts of data. PHP doesn't have brilliant support for multithreading or a good API for Java has a couple of APIs for processing XML and I wanted to try them all.

Mar 4, 2015 You can also introduce multi-threading with a pool of finite number of in detail – Processing large files efficiently in Java – multi-threaded  May 22, 2019 Java Thread Tutorial: Creating Threads and Multithreading in Java and the user selects to perform a download and check afterward, the  We have one application using which users downloads files from ftp.. files are very large in size say about (400MB). As per existing application,  Sample application that manages multiple segmented downloads and supports Hosting and Servers · Java · Linux Programming . In this way, we can have multi-requests for the same files running in parallel using multi-threading techniques. Sometimes, you need to download an big ZIP file just because you want a 

The file size tends to vary from a few mb to 500 mb. A suggestion has come up that we should maybe support multi-threading when uploading the files to the shared location - not required to do it in byte chunks - each thread should pick one file and try to upload. I am not so sure if multithreading can speed up IO operations like this.

Processing large files efficiently in Java – multi-threaded code – part 2. Processing large files efficiently in Java The main thread spawns 1 producer thread and x number of consumer threads in a fixed thread pool. The producer is responsible for reading a line at a time from the file, and insert in to a “BlockingQueue”. Java Based Heavy-duty utilitity to process large delimited text files TextZilla is a Multithreaded Java utility which can process huge size delimited text files to extract, convert, encode, decode, encrypt/decrypt text data from source and write it in desired output file or files. Conclusion – MappedByteBuffer wins for file sizes up to 1 GB. Java nio MappedByteBuffer performs the best for large files, and followed by Java 8. Monitor your application to see if it is more I/O bound, memory bound, or CPU bound. When reading a file larger than 1.0 GB into memory. You can get “OutOfMemoryError“s. To create three threads for reading the file and three threads for getting the strings out of the queue and printing them. thanks Toggle navigation. Java Thread for reading txt file. Reading big file in Java How to read a big text file in Java program? Hi Java multithread download library. Contribute to daimajia/java-multithread-downloader development by creating an account on GitHub. Java multithread download library. Contribute to daimajia/java-multithread-downloader development by creating an account on GitHub. mission. getReadableSize() // get mission target file size (which is readable My task was to build a multi-thread file server and a client that can upload or download a named file over sockets. It is assumed that the client will finish after its operation and there is no need to supply a file list from the server (although I plan to add that).

1 Mar 2013 in Java. It also uses multiple threads to traverse the directories, but it performs 3.5 Example Timings for pct Copying “Few Large Files” Set .

Once enabled multithreading works with the normal download test and auto test. Some connections perform best when loading multiple files, the multithread  Sep 28, 2009 Tackling the file I/O bottleneck. Over the past year or so, we've heard a lot about multithreading, deadlocks, cache invalidation, and For multiple files I/O, each file had 20MB. Read and write caches explain some of the huge throughput of the RAID system used. Download the latest issue today. >> 

Jan 4, 2019 The challenge was straightforward enough: download this large zip file of text from the Federal Elections Commission, read that data out of the 

Java is object-oriented language and as such the creation of new class instances (objects) is, probably, the most important concept of it. Constructors are playing a central role in new class instance initialization and Java provides a couple of favors to define them. 1.2.1Implicit (Generated) Constructor

Contribute to daimajia/java-multithread-downloader development by creating an java-multithread-downloader/library/com/zhan_dui/download/DownloadRunnable.java File;. import java.io.IOException;. import java.io.RandomAccessFile;.